88% of Companies See Sustainability as a Value-Creation Opportunity: Morgan Stanley Survey – ESG Today

Home ESG Business
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Almost 9 out of ten firms view sustainability as a worth creation alternative, anticipated to drive advantages together with increased profitability, income progress and improved price of capital, in line with a brand new survey launched by Morgan Stanely, which additionally discovered that firms have gotten more and more adept at quantifying the ROI of sustainability investments, enabling higher comparisons to different capital allocation priorities.

For the report, “Sustainable Indicators: Corporates 2025,” Morgan Stanley surveyed executives at greater than 330 firms with revenues better than $100 million throughout North America, Europe and APAC, and representing a broad vary of industries.

The survey discovered that firms more and more view sustainability as a chance to create worth, with 88% of respondents reporting seeing sustainability as a having a worth creation impression on their firms’ long-term technique, up 3 proportion factors over final 12 months, together with 53% who view it primarily as worth creation, and 35% as a mixture of worth creation and danger administration.

Notably, essentially the most vital progress by firms in seeing a worth creation side to sustainability was in North America and Europe, growing 9 proportion factors to 89%, and 10 proportion factors to 94%, respectively over the prior 12 months’s survey.

Elevated profitability topped the listing of the first ways in which sustainability may drive worth creation alternatives for firms over the following 5 years, cited by 25% of respondents, adopted by increased income progress at 19% and decrease price of capital, in addition to improved money circulation visibility at 13% every.

Along with anticipating sustainability-related worth creation alternatives, the survey additionally discovered that firms have gotten adept at measuring the anticipated returns from their initiatives, with 83% of executives now reporting that they’ll measure the ROI for his or her sustainability actions in an identical strategy to non-sustainability initiatives, enabling higher capital allocation capabilities when evaluating with different priorities.

Moreover, the survey additionally indicated that firms have gotten extra assured of their sustainability progress, with 65% of executives describing their firms’ sustainability technique as assembly or exceeding expectations, up from simply 59% final 12 months. The elevated confidence spanned all areas, with North America reaching 65% from 61% final 12 months, Europe at 69% vs 63%, and APAC at 60% in contrast with 53%.

The survey additionally assessed executives’ views on essentially the most vital challenges and potential enablers of their firms sustainability methods. “Excessive stage of funding required” as soon as once more topped the listing of high boundaries globally, cited by 24% of respondents’ as a high 3 alternative, adopted by political volatility or uncertainty at 17%. Notably, North American buyers have been more likely than their international friends to pick out “political volatility or uncertainty” as a sustainability barrier.

Concerning enablers, the survey discovered that essentially the most generally cited elements chosen by executives as an important in delivering on their sustainability methods have been technological developments, at 33%, adopted intently by a good financial and working setting at 32%, and rising buyer demand at 28%.

As executives more and more view sustainability as a worth creation alternative, the survey additionally discovered a rising consciousness of danger. In response to the report, 57% of executives reported that their firms have skilled climate-related occasions over the previous 12 months that impacted operations, with APAC respondents the most definitely at 73%. Probably the most generally cited occasions included excessive warmth at 55% of respondents, adopted by excessive climate or storms, at 53%, and wildfires or smoke, at 36%.

Particular climate-related enterprise impacts skilled over the previous 12 months included elevated operational prices at 54%, disruptions to the workforce at 40%, and income loss as a result of enterprise interruptions or provide chain failures at 39%.

Importantly, 60% anticipate unfavorable impacts from bodily local weather dangers within the subsequent 5 years, in line with the survey, and greater than two-thirds additionally anticipate seeing their companies impacted by local weather transition dangers as properly.

Regardless of acknowledging climate-related dangers, nevertheless, greater than 80% of respondents reported that they really feel that their firms are “very” (34%) or “considerably” (54%) ready to extend resilience in opposition to climate-related threats.

Jessica Alsford, Chief Sustainability Officer and Chair of the Institute for Sustainable Investing at Morgan Stanley, stated:

“The information recommend that sustainability stays central to long-term worth creation. Firms world wide report an alignment between company methods and sustainability priorities as they search to construct resilient, future-ready companies.”
